Graduate Certificate of Environmental Management
This Graduate Certificate provides you with an understanding of current issues and approaches to environmental management; of current regulatory and policy frameworks and the ability to contribute to the governance of environmental sustainability and disasters.

Entry requirements
- A Bachelor degree or international equivalent with GPA 4/7
- A Graduate Diploma or international equivalent with a GPA 4/7
- A Graduate Certificate or international equivalent with a GPA 4/7
- 24 units of courses in a postgraduate program a GPA of 4/7
- Graduate Records Examination (GRE) General test, completed no more than 5 years before the time of application, with a minimum score of 155 for Verbal Reasoning, 155 for Quantitative Reasoning and 4.0 in Analytical Writing AND a minimum of 3 years full time equivalent work experience at ANZSCO Skill Level 1 in a field related to the program
- A minimum 5 years full time equivalent work experience at ANZSCO Skill Level 1 in a field related to the program
